SABIC debuts high-purity sd1100p dianhydride for flexible PI films to help improve speed in 5G devices

SABIC today introduced its new high-purity SD1100P specialty dianhydride powder for polyimide (PI) film formulations for potential use in 5G flexible printed circuit boards (PCBs), colorless displays and other flexible electronics applications.SABIC today introduced its new high-purity SD1100P specialty dianhydride powder for polyimide (PI) film formulations for potential use in 5G flexible printed circuit boards (PCBs), colorless displays and other flexible electronics applications. This 4,4’-bisphenol A dianhydride (BPADA) powder helps customers produce high molecular weight PI formulations that can deliver improved balance between thermal and mechanical properties. Compared to other commercially available dianhydrides, SABIC’s SD1100P BPADA powder may offer performance improvements including a lower dielectric constant and dissipation factor, reduced water absorption and improved metal adhesion for creating films and varnishes used in copper-clad laminates, coverlays and adhesives.

SABIC’s new ELCRES HTV150 dielectric film performs at 150°C, improving the efficiency of inverter modules for electric vehicles

SABIC introduced today its new 5-micron ELCRES™ HTV150 dielectric film for high-temperature, high-voltage, professional-grade capacitor applications, such as traction inverters for hybrid, plug-in hybrid and battery electric vehicles (xEV).SABIC, a global leader in the chemical industry, introduced today its new 5-micron ELCRES HTV150 dielectric film for high-temperature, high-voltage, professional-grade capacitor applications, such as traction inverters for hybrid, plug-in hybrid and battery electric vehicles (xEV). This new film, featuring high-heat performance up to 150°C, surpasses the temperature and voltage capabilities of incumbent products. ELCRES HTV150 film can help support the transition from conventional semiconductors based on silicon (Si) to next-generation, wide-band-gap technologies based on silicon carbide (SiC), improving the efficiency of inverter modules.

SABIC is a frontrunner in industry to launch recycled ocean bound plastics portfolio

SABIC has announced the launch of a new recycled material made from ocean bound plastic.SABIC, a global leader in the chemical industry, has announced the launch of a new recycled material made from ocean bound plastic which has been recovered from ocean-feeding waterways and inland areas within a 50 kilometer radius of the ocean. The ocean bound material is mechanically recycled and converted into components for new consumer goods and electronics applications, such as TV remote controls and electronic razors. It has the potential to also be used in other industries in the future, such as automotive.
